How to Pick Lipstick Colors that Make a Statement!

Choosing the right lipstick color can be challenging, but it’s important to select a shade that complements your skin tone. Here are some general guidelines to help you choose a lipstick color based on your skin tone:

  • Fair skin tone – Soft pinks, light corals, and peachy nude shades are ideal for fair skin tones. These shades add a subtle pop of color without overwhelming the complexion. It’s best to avoid shades that are too dark or too bold, as they can look overpowering and may not complement the fair skin tone.
  • Light skin tone – Light pink, mauve, and berry shades are flattering for light skin tones. These shades add a touch of color to the lips without being too overpowering. For a bolder look, try a bright red or deep burgundy shade, as these can add contrast and drama to a light complexion.
  • Medium skin tone – Brown, rose, and coral shades work well for medium skin tones. These shades add warmth to the complexion and complement the skin’s natural undertones. For a more dramatic look, try a bold orange or bright pink shade, as these can add a pop of color and contrast to medium skin tones.
  • Olive skin tone – Nude, brown, and deep red shades complement olive skin tones. These shades add depth and definition to the lips without overpowering the natural beauty of the complexion. It’s best to avoid shades that are too light or too pastel, as they can wash out the complexion and make the skin appear dull.
  • Dark skin tone – Deep berry, purple, and brown shades are stunning on dark skin tones. These shades add drama and contrast to the complexion and complement the skin’s natural undertones. For a more dramatic look, try a bold orange or fuchsia shade, as these can add a pop of color and contrast to dark skin tones.

top 10 tricks to prevent kajal from smudging works 100%

Kajal a popular cosmetic product used to enhance the beauty of the eyes.However there is one common problem faced by many women is that kajal tends to smudge easily, giving an untidy appearance to the eyes. Here are the top 10 tricks to prevent kajal from smudging 👁👁

  • Choose the right type of kajal: Select a kajal that is waterproof and smudge-proof.
  • Prime your eyelids: Apply a small amount of primer on your eyelids before applying kajal. This will help the kajal stick better to your eyelids and prevent it from smudging.
  • Apply a thin layer: Apply a thin layer of kajal instead of a thick one. A thick layer of kajal is more likely to smudge.
  • Use a tissue paper: After applying kajal, hold a tissue paper below your eyes and blink a few times. This will remove any excess kajal and prevent smudging.
  • Use a setting spray: Apply a setting spray on your eyelids after applying kajal. This will help the kajal stay in place for a longer period.
  • Use an eyeliner pencil: Use an eyeliner pencil instead of kajal to avoid smudging. An eyeliner pencil has a waxier texture that is less prone to smudging.
  • Avoid rubbing your eyes: Avoid rubbing your eyes as this can cause the kajal to smudge.
  • Use a smudge-proof mascara: If you are using mascara, make sure to use a smudge-proof one. This will prevent the mascara from smudging and spreading to your kajal.
  • Avoid oily products: Avoid using oily products on your face, as they can cause the kajal to smudge.
  • Use a powder: Apply a small amount of translucent powder on your eyelids after applying kajal. This will help the kajal set and prevent it from smudging.

top 5 anti-aging ingredients to look for in a face cream

When looking for an anti-aging face cream, look for products that contain one or more of these ingredients to help keep your skin looking youthful and radiant.

  • Retinol – Retinol is a form of vitamin A that helps to stimulate collagen production and increase skin cell turnover. This can help to reduce the appearance of fine lines, wrinkles, and age spots.
  • Vitamin C – Vitamin C is a powerful antioxidant that helps to protect the skin from free radical damage, which can accelerate the aging process. It also helps to brighten the skin and improve skin tone.
  • Hyaluronic acid – Hyaluronic acid is a humectant that helps to hydrate and plump the skin, reducing the appearance of fine lines and wrinkles.
  • Niacinamide – Niacinamide is a form of vitamin B3 that helps to improve skin texture and reduce the appearance of fine lines and wrinkles. It also helps to regulate oil production, making it suitable for all skin types.
  • Peptides – Peptides are amino acids that help to stimulate collagen production and improve skin elasticity. This can help to reduce the appearance of fine lines and wrinkles and improve skin firmness.

Apply 7 Drops daily – Glass Skin Serum

The goal of achieving glass skin is to have a complexion that appears radiant, hydrated, and healthy, with a visible glow that makes the skin look almost transparent.Here’s a simple DIY recipe for a glass skin serum.

Ingredients:

  • 1 ripe tomato
  • 1/2 orange
  • 1 tablespoon rose water
  • 1 tablespoon glycerin

Method:

  • Blend the ripe tomato and half of an orange in a blender until smooth.
  • Strain the mixture to remove any pulp or seeds.
  • Add the rose water and glycerin to the mixture and stir well to combine.
  • Transfer the mixture to a small glass bottle with a dropper.
  • To use, apply a few drops of the serum to your face and neck after cleansing and toning. Massage gently in circular motions until fully absorbed.

Tomatoes contain lycopene, which is a powerful antioxidant that helps to protect the skin from damage caused by free radicals. They also contain vitamin C, which helps to brighten the skin and reduce hyperpigmentation. Oranges are rich in vitamin C, which helps to boost collagen production and improve skin texture. Rose water is a natural astringent that helps to tighten and tone the skin. Glycerin is a humectant that helps to hydrate and soften the skin

Remember, consistency is key when it comes to skincare.Using the serum daily can help you achieve the glass skin look you desire.

Banish Blackheads, Whiteheads and Get Polished Skin : The Ultimate Deep Cleansing Solution!

Performing a deep cleansing of your skin using home remedies is a natural and cost-effective way to keep your skin looking healthy, clear, polished skin free from blackheads, pimples and whiteheads. Here is a step-by-step guide to performing a deep cleansing using home remedies:

  • Start by washing your face with warm water to remove any surface-level dirt and oil. You can use a gentle cleanser or just plain water.
  • Use this natural exfoliant to remove dead skin cells, blackheads and unclog pores.Mix equal parts of fine coffee powder or fine rice powder with water to create a paste and gently massage it onto your skin. Rinse it off with warm water.Be gentle and avoid over-exfoliating or applying too much pressure.
  • Steam your face by holding it over a bowl of hot water for 5-10 minutes.Add a few drops of essential oils like tea tree oil, orange or lavender oil to the water for added benefits.
  • Use clay-based natural face mask to draw out impurities and keep your skin free from pimples and whiteheads.You can mix equal parts of fuller’s earth and plain yogurt with a few drops of honey to create a nourishing face mask. Apply the mask to your face and leave it on for 20 minutes before rinsing it off with warm water.

  • Use a toner to balance your skin’s pH and tighten pores. You can mix equal parts of cucumber juice and rose water and apply it to your face using a cotton ball.
  • Finish by moisturizing your skin with a natural moisturizer like organic coconut oil , jojoba or olive oil.

Boost Your Brainpower and Memory with These 3 Easy & Delicious Nutty Ladoos

These ladoos are a delicious and nutritious way to enjoy the brain-boosting benefits of nuts. Just remember to consume them in moderation as they are high in calories.

  • Almond ladoos: Soak 1 cup of almonds in water overnight, peel off the skin, and blend them into a smooth paste. Heat a pan and add the almond paste, 1 cup of sugar, and 1/2 cup of ghee. Cook on low heat, stirring constantly, until the mixture thickens and starts to come together. Add cardamom powder and mix well. Allow the mixture to cool slightly, then shape into small balls or ladoos.
  • Walnut ladoos: In a pan, roast 1 cup of chopped walnuts until lightly toasted. Add 1 cup of jaggery, 1/2 cup of ghee, and a pinch of cardamom powder. Cook on low heat until the jaggery melts and the mixture starts to come together. Allow the mixture to cool slightly, then shape into small balls or ladoos.
  • Cashew ladoos: In a blender, grind 1 cup of cashews into a fine powder. Heat a pan and add the cashew powder, 1 cup of sugar, and 1/2 cup of ghee. Cook on low heat, stirring constantly, until the mixture thickens and starts to come together. Add cardamom powder and mix well. Allow the mixture to cool slightly, then shape into small balls or ladoos.

10 Tricks to Prevent Foundation Oxidation – Your Foundation Will Stay True to Color All Day Long!”

By following these simple tricks, I guarantee that you can prevent your foundation from oxidizing and enjoy a flawless, long-lasting finish.

  • Choose the right shade: The most important trick to prevent foundation from oxidizing is to choose the right shade. Test the foundation in natural light and choose a shade that matches your skin tone.
  • Use a primer: Applying a primer before your foundation can help to create a smooth base for your makeup and prevent the foundation from getting oxidized.
  • Set with powder: Setting your foundation with a powder can help to control oil and prevent oxidation.
  • Avoid heavy moisturizers: Heavy moisturizers can make your foundation slip and slide, leading to oxidation. Opt for lightweight moisturizers that are quickly absorbed into the skin.
  • Blot excess oil: Use blotting papers or a tissue to remove excess oil from your skin throughout the day. Excess oil can cause foundation to oxidize.
  • Apply in thin layers: Applying your foundation in thin layers can help to prevent oxidation. Thick layers of foundation are more likely to react with air and cause oxidation.
  • Use a matte foundation: Matte foundations are less likely to oxidize than dewy or luminous foundations. If you have oily skin, a matte foundation may be a good option for you.
  • Use a setting spray: A setting spray can help to lock in your foundation and prevent it from oxidizing throughout the day.
  • Avoid touching your face: Touching your face throughout the day can transfer oils and bacteria to your skin, causing foundation to oxidize.
  • Store foundation properly: Heat and sunlight can cause foundation to break down and oxidize. Store your foundation in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ight to prevent oxidation.

  • Avocado Youthful Face Mask – Mash 1/2 ripe avocado and mix with 1 tablespoon of honey. Apply to face and leave on for 15 minutes before rinsing off with warm water.This face mask is great for hydrating and nourishing the skin. Avocado is rich in healthy fats and antioxidants that help to soothe and protect the skin, while honey provides natural antibacterial properties that can help to reduce acne and inflammation.
  • Oatmeal Brightening Face Mask – Mix 1 tablespoon of oatmeal with 1 tablespoon of plain yogurt and 1 teaspoon of honey. Apply to face and leave on for 10 minutes before rinsing off with warm water.This face mask is perfect for exfoliating and brightening the skin. Oatmeal helps to remove dead skin cells and unclog pores, while yogurt and honey provide natural sources of lactic acid and antioxidants that help to brighten and even out skin tone.

  • Turmeric Dark Spot Removal Face Mask – Mix 1 teaspoon of turmeric powder with 1 tablespoon of honey and 1 teaspoon of plain yogurt. Apply to face and leave on for 15 minutes before rinsing off with warm water.his face mask is ideal for reducing inflammation and promoting a glowing complexion. Turmeric contains curcumin, which has powerful anti-inflammatory properties that can help to soothe irritated skin, while honey and yogurt provide natural sources of antioxidants that can help to brighten and protect the skin.
  • Banana Skin Tightening Face Mask – Mash 1/2 ripe banana and mix with 1 tablespoon of honey and 1 tablespoon of plain yogurt. Apply to face and leave on for 15-20 minutes before rinsing off with warm water.This face mask is great for hydrating and soothing dry or sensitive skin. Banana is rich in vitamins and minerals that help to nourish and hydrate the skin, while honey and yogurt provide natural antibacterial and anti-inflammatory properties that can help to reduce acne and inflammation.
  • Cucumber Pore Minimizing Face Mask – Grate 1/2 cucumber and mix with 1 tablespoon of fresh malai and 1 tablespoon of aloe vera gel. Apply to face and leave on for 15 minutes before rinsing off with warm water.This face mask is perfect for refreshing and soothing the skin. Cucumber contains natural cooling properties that can help to soothe and hydrate the skin, while honey and aloe vera provide natural sources of antioxidants and anti-inflammatory properties that can help to reduce redness and inflammation.
